Airport Tanger
Tanger Ibn Battouta Airport (IATA: TNG, ICAO: GMTT) is the main international airport serving the city of Tangier, Morocco. It is located approximately 9 kilometers (5.6 miles) from the city center.The airport features a modern, single-terminal building that handles both domestic and international flights. Some key facts about Tanger Ibn Battouta Airport:
- Runway Dimensions: 3,200 m x 45 m (10,499 ft x 148 ft), capable of accommodating large aircraft.
- Terminal Area: The terminal has a total area of 26,550 sq m (285,782 sq ft).
- Facilities: The terminal includes basic amenities like check-in counters, baggage claim, a few shops and eateries, and free WiFi access.
- Transportation: Taxis are available 24/7 outside the terminal, and there are car rental desks inside. No public bus service is available.
- Airlines: The airport is served by a variety of airlines, including Air Arabia, Ryanair, Iberia, and Royal Air Maroc, connecting Tangier to destinations in Europe and Morocco.
Tangier Airport is an important gateway for travelers visiting the northern region of Morocco. It provides a convenient entry point to explore the city of Tangier, as well as nearby attractions like the Strait of Gibraltar and the Rif Mountains.While the airport facilities are relatively basic compared to larger hubs, the airport staff is known to be friendly and helpful, even for passengers who don’t speak Arabic. Overall, Tanger Ibn Battouta Airport offers a functional and efficient travel experience for those visiting the Tangier area.
